Food Security in Russia: Current State and Prospects

Student: Gayvoronskiy Igor

Supervisor: Alina Shcherbakova

Faculty: Faculty of World Economy and International Affairs

Educational Programme: World Economy (Master)

Year of Graduation: 2018

Food security is one of the key elements determining the quality of life of the population and the possibility of sustainable development of country. The level of food security depends on many indicators, including those determined by the individual characteristics of the region. These indicators and the very concept of food security are the subject of research by many different foreign and domestic scientists. However, despite widespread attention to food security issues, many aspects of this field remain controversial and require further study. In particular, the issue of food security and its characteristics in the conditions of modern Russia has not been sufficiently studied. This work examines the dynamics and current state of Russia's food security.
